#1117ed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1117ed is composed of 6.7% red, 9%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.8% cyan, 90.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 238.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.6% and a lightness of 49.8%. #1117ed color hex could be obtained by blending #222eff with #0000db. Closest websafe color is: #0000ff.

Shades and Tints of #1117ed

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010211 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1117ed

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7d82 is the less saturated color, while #070ef7 is the most saturated one.
